A Minor 7th, Flat 5th Banjo Chord

also known as A half-diminished 7th, A half-diminished

  • your first finger goes on the fourth fret of the second string
  • your second finger goes on the fifth fret of the third string
  • your third finger goes on the fifth fret of the first string
  • your fourth finger goes on the seventh fret of the fourth string
Diagram of an A minor 7th, flat 5th banjo chord at the 4 fret

Notes in an A Minor 7th, Flat 5th Banjo chord

Root : A

Minor 3rd : C

Diminished 5th : D#

Minor 7th : G
